Here's a surefire way to get started on eBay without much capital and with an equal chance of being as successful as anyone else on eBay.
First take a moment to take the get started tour and take get familiar with the site. As with most things, it's best if you follow the "no dessert until you eat your veggies" standard. If your so anxious to dive right in and don't want to take an extended start tour, at the least read the FAQs for sellers and buyers. The time you invest here will be as important as anything you do on eBay.

Jumping right in. Start by selling the things you have and don't need any longer. If this can be in the collectibles category, great, this is eBay's forte. If you really don't have any collectibles, take an inventory and just ask yourself what you could see people paying good money for out of what your willing part with. List that first, then list even the things you think won't sell well, you'll be surprised. Try to list at least 10 items your first time.

Pay attention to patterns of what sells and how it sells. For example, very few things do well alone, most items do much better when you list them along with many other listings at the same time. Your going to find that the more you list at one time, the more bidding activity you get because of the exponential benefit of cross marketing with eBay's huge user base.
